Written question asked by James Cleverly (Conservative) on Wednesday, 10 June 2026, in the House of Commons. It was due for an answer on Monday, 15 June 2026. It was answered by Alison McGovern (Labour) on Tuesday, 16 June 2026 on behalf of the Ministry of Housing, Communities and Local Government.


Tower Hamlets Council

Question

To ask the Secretary of State for Housing, Communities and Local Government, further to the publication of, London Borough of Tower Hamlets: Letter to the Secretary of State from the Ministerial Envoys, 20 January 2026, and with reference to answer of 20 April 2026, to Question 124686, on Tower Hamlets Council, if he will list the stakeholders who have raised concerns about patronage.

Answer

The Ministerial Envoys are undertaking a deep dive project as part of the strengthened intervention package that was set out in the Directions on 17 March 2026, to provide assurance in relation to long-standing concerns, including in relation to patronage in recruitment. A list of stakeholders who have raised concerns will not be disclosed as doing so would involve the release of personal data and information provided in confidence and breach GDPR requirements on handling personal data.
